Are you passionate about building apps and do you want to reach millions of users through your code? Join us in building solutions that use the latest technologies and engage with likeminded people that deliver world class products.
Be the voice that guides customers through expert advice. Gather and inform requests for features to improve efficiency, performance and usability. Troubleshoot issues and correct software defects introducing automated tests that result in robust implementations.
Finally, get a chance to document projects, create customer software manuals and develop prototypes for new software technologies.
Jump straight into collaboration and pairing with peers using every opportunity to grow. Plot your career using our Engineering Growth Framework to take the path best suited for you.
RESPONSIBILITIES
- Keep up to date with the latest platform developments
- Maintain and extend existing development activities
- Work with customers to determine project requirements
- Develop software from requirements and specifications
- Identify and eliminate software defects
- Improve the quality of the codebase through refactoring and introducing unit and UI automation testing
- Participate in the mentoring culture
- Drive and grow the engineering team through engagement
EDUCATION
- BS/MS degree in Computer Science, Engineering or related field, or equivalent experience
EXPERIENCE
- Experience in Objective-C / Swift / UIKit and other native iOS frameworks is required
- SwiftUI experience is a bonus
- Experience testing and in test automation
- Experience in creating and using CocoaPods / SwiftPM
- Experience using source control systems and CI / CD
- Demonstrate debugging and problem solving skills
- A curious, passionate, growth-oriented mindset
- Excellent written and verbal communication skills (English)
- Emotional intelligence, empathy and ability to establish trusting and strong relationships
- Ability to focus on deadlines and deliverables
- Desire to learn new technologies
REMUNERATION OVERVIEW
Below is an overview on remuneration and benefits:
REMUNERATION
- Junior Developer salary up to R34K based on experience
- Intermediate Developer salary up to R70K based on experience
- Senior Developer salary up to R90K based on experience and leadership / managerial experience
- Group Scheme Benefits (Details on Company Contributions)
- Medical Aid: (Glucode will contribute 2% of your base salary towards your monthly medical aid) if you select to join the group medical scheme.
- Group Life Scheme: Employees are added to the group life scheme after being employed with the Company for 3 months. This covers life cover, funeral cover, chronic illness and severe disability. Benefit amount to be confirmed.
- Cellphone/ Data Allowance: After working for the Company for 3 months you are eligible for the data/cellphone allowance up to a maximum of R500 per month.
- Personal device insurance: Your personal mobile device can be added to the Company’s group insurance at no cost to you. It’s not compulsory but an added benefit that the Company offers.
OTHER BENEFITS
- Fitness Watch – To encourage employees to take care of their health and fitness, eligibility for the fitness watch benefit is after completing 36 months (3 years) service.
- Office Allowance – The world of work is evolving, and we have adopted a hybrid way of working. We wanted to assist employees to have a comfortable and productive remote working environment. Every 3 (three) years they will receive an allowance of R 5 000.00 to spend on their remote working setup. New joiners shall receive this benefit after being in the Company’s employment for 3 months.
REWARDS
- First Bonus – If the Company did not make a loss during the previous FY, a bonus equivalent to 1 (one) month’s salary will be awarded and paid with the November pay run.
- Second Bonus – If the Company met its profit targets for the previous FY, an additional bonus equivalent of 1 (one) month’s salary will be awarded and paid out as per the following schedule:
- January – 25%
- May – 75%
Desired Skills:
- Swift
- Objective-C
- IOS frameworks
- CocoaPods
About The Employer:
Glucode is a Software Company that solves problems to create apps that people love.
We take pride in building our own products that solve meaningful problems that impacts users’ lives for the better.
We also provide a range of tailored services that help our clients create engaging and memorable mobile user experiences. We design, develop and deliver services predominantly for native mobile platforms.
We’re perfectionists, idealists and inventors. Forever tinkering with technology and processes
Who we are as a Company, including our benefits, rewards, recognition, this is all detailed in our handbook which can be accessed here:
(https://handbook.glucode.com)
For additional information visit our?website (www.glucode.com) and follow our?LinkedIn page